Written by Edgar Jacobs who knew Herge and worked with him for a while. Jacobs started his own graphic novels featuring Blake and Mortimer and set in an alternate history world of the 1950's. The adventures are based in London but travel far and wide. They are crime stories and 1950's sci-fi. Jacobs died in '87 but his work has been continued by new artists and writers. They are originally in French and have been translated in the new millennium.
